Compare it to The Wall for example. In TFC, the guitar never varies from basic repetitive notes, the vocals always carry similar emotions, the lyrics never stray from resigned rage and depression. I'm not saying any of those things are inherently bad, but there's no variation. The Wall has a lot more variation, which makes it more enjoyable to listen to the whole thing.
